Revision: 3988
Author: [email protected]
Date: Tue Nov 16 08:27:40 2010
Log: Fixed table size bugs (if you save then load an enterprise project,
table borders were wrong!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!111111oneone)
http://code.google.com/p/power-architect/source/detail?r=3988
Modified:
/trunk/src/main/java/ca/sqlpower/architect/swingui/TablePane.java
=======================================
--- /trunk/src/main/java/ca/sqlpower/architect/swingui/TablePane.java Mon
Nov 8 14:07:45 2010
+++ /trunk/src/main/java/ca/sqlpower/architect/swingui/TablePane.java Tue
Nov 16 08:27:40 2010
@@ -304,7 +304,8 @@
updateHiddenColumns();
firePropertyChange("model.children", null, e.getChild());
//$NON-NLS-1$
- //revalidate();
+ setLengths(getUI().getPreferredSize());
+ repaint();
}
/**
@@ -339,10 +340,10 @@
// no matter where the event came from, we should no longer be
listening to the removed children
SQLPowerUtils.unlistenToHierarchy(e.getChild(), this);
-// updateNameDisplay();
updateHiddenColumns();
firePropertyChange("model.children", e.getChild(), null);
//$NON-NLS-1$
- //revalidate();
+ setLengths(getUI().getPreferredSize());
+ repaint();
}
/**
@@ -358,10 +359,10 @@
" oldVal="+e.getOldValue()+"
newVal="+e.getNewValue() + //$NON-NLS-1$ //$NON-NLS-2$
" selectedItems=" + getSelectedItems());
}
-// updateNameDisplay();
updateHiddenColumns();
firePropertyChange("model."+e.getPropertyName(),
e.getOldValue(), e.getNewValue()); //$NON-NLS-1$
- //repaint();
+ setLengths(getUI().getPreferredSize());
+ repaint();
}
public void transactionEnded(TransactionEvent e) {